Observations of Range Hood Usage in Everyday Life
Range hoods are an integral part of many kitchens, installed above the stove to remove airborne grease, combustion products, smoke, odors, heat, and steam. The lights serve a functional purpose, illuminating the cooking area to improve visibility while preparing meals. However, the use and habits surrounding these lights vary widely among households.
Understanding the Function of Range Hood Lights
Range hood lights are designed to provide focused illumination over the stovetop. This can aid in cooking, ensuring food is cooked properly and safely by enhancing visibility. Typically, these lights are used intermittently, switched on during cooking or when extra light is needed in the kitchen.

Potential Safety Concerns of Overnight Use
Regarding safety, modern range hood lights are generally low-risk appliances. However, like any electrical device, prolonged use may lead to increased wear or potential hazards if the equipment is faulty. Ensuring that the range hood is well-maintained can mitigate these risks.
Energy Consumption and Cost Implications
Leaving the lights on overnight does add to electricity usage, albeit minimally in most cases. However, the cost can accumulate over time, especially with less energy-efficient bulbs. Consumers conscious of their energy footprint might consider this when deciding whether to leave the lights on.
Alternative Solutions and Best Practices
For those who want a lit kitchen at night but prefer not to leave range hood lights on, alternatives include using energy-efficient LED nightlights or motion-sensor lights. These can provide sufficient illumination with lower energy consumption. Best practices suggest turning off lights when not in use to conserve energy and extend the lifespan of the bulbs.
